Bob “the Wiz” Ellis was a coach, father, friend, and pillar of the community. In everything the Wiz did he emphasized hard work and dedication to achieve success not only on the athletic field but also in the classroom. Wiz, an admirer of the late Coach John Wooden, lived by his quote:
Success comes from knowing that you did your best to become the best that you are capable of becoming.
It is in this spirit that the Wiz Scholarship Fund will reward a valuable candidate who best fulfills the criteria of this scholarship.
Award: $1,000
Criteria: Strong academic record, participation in an Alter sport as player or manager, history of hard work on the athletic field, community service.
Essay: How has your Catholic education helped you become a servant leader?
Reference: N/ A
Additional Information required:
- Cumulative GPA through first semester of senior year
- List of athletic participation at Alter
- Extracurricular activities during high school
- Any awards earned: academic, athletic, leadership or servant, etc.
- List all other scholarships you have applied for college/trade school
- Plans for post-secondary education upon your graduation from Alter
Renewability: 3 years for a bachelor’s degree, l year -trade school
